EU releases draft of what it wants Apple to open up on iOS to third parties

Now we know why our valiant defender of privacy Apple went crying to Reuters yesterday about big mean data stealing Meta - the EU Commission released their draft recommendations on what Apple should be doing in order to comply with the DMA's interoperability measures. You can read the details on the proposed measures the EU wants in this PDF. It's stuff like better access to notifications, improved app background execution, audio switching, better performance for peer-to-peer wi-fi, AirPlay, close-range file transfers, accessibility features and heaps more. Apple's propaganda machine spat out a 5 page PDF saying how interoperability is a risk to privacy so third party developers should be second class citizens and the only people you can trust are Apple.

Facebook moderators in Kenya suffering through major mental health issues

Over 140 Facebook moderators working in Kenya for a company called Samasource have sued their employers after being diagnosed with severe post-traumatic stress disorder, generalised anxiety disorder and major depressive disorder. I don't think it's much of a stretch to imagine why their brains are fucked up after moderating Facebook, but they claim viewing "images and videos including necrophilia, bestiality and self-harm" in 8 to 10 hour working days, caused them to abuse drugs and alcohol to cope which then led to other problems in their life - all while being paid "eight times less than their counterparts in the US". Home Assistant Voice is HA's new hardware device for private voice smart home control

The Open Home Foundation has announced Home Assistant Voice, a little US$59 box with an ESP32 and microphone and speaker that ties into HA natively via Bluetooth so it can interpret voice commands locally or in the cloud. It even has a Grove port for hanging sensors off it. The killer feature is probably being able to run all the voice commands locally - better latency and more privacy! The kicker is that you need something beefier than a Raspberry Pi for your HA server, like an Intel N100 mini PC. HA also released the firmware source code and blueprints to print your own enclosure.
